FJ Cruiser 4WD V6-4.0L (1GR-FE) (2007)

(a)
Install the No. 2 camshaft onto the bank 1 cylinder head with the cam lobes of No. 1 cylinder facing upward as shown in the illustration.
(b) Install the 4 bearing caps in the proper locations as shown.
(c)
Apply a light coat of engine oil to the threads and under the heads of the bearing cap bolts.
(d) Using several steps, uniformly install and tighten the 8 bearing cap bolts in the sequence shown in the illustration.
Torque:
10 mm (0.39 in.) head 9.0 N*m (92 kgf*cm, 80 in.*lbf.)
12 mm (0.47 in.) head 24 N*m (245 kgf*cm, 18 ft.*lbf.)
(e)
Rotate the No. 2 camshaft clockwise using a wrench so that the knock pin of the No. 2 camshaft is aligned with the knock pin hole in the
camshaft timing gear.
(f)
Hold the hexagonal portion of the No. 2 camshaft with a wrench, and install the camshaft timing gear set bolt.
Torque: 100 N*m (1,020 kgf*cm, 74 ft.*lbf.)
(g) Remove the pin from the No. 2 chain tensioner.
